How Reliable is the Rover 214?

Based on 1,033,973 MOT tests across 183,124 vehicles.

67.6%
Pass Rate
4,425
Miles/Year
36
Year Lifespan
183,124
On UK Roads

Top MOT Failure Points

Tyre tread depth below requirements of 1.6mm 67,012
Exhaust emissions carbon monoxide content after 2nd fast idle excessive 49,655
Brake pipe excessively corroded 42,958
Exhaust has a major leak of exhaust gases 40,016
Windscreen wiper does not clear the windscreen effectively 34,983

M849 LVP is a 1994 Rover 214 in Red with a 1,396cc petrol engine. This vehicle has been through 31 MOT tests with a personal pass rate of 61.3%.

Across all 1994 Rover 214 models, the average MOT pass rate is 66.2% with a typical mileage of 85,913 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.

The most common reason a Rover 214 f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 67,012 recorded failures. If you're considering buying M849 LVP, it's worth having these areas checked by a mechanic before committing.

The Rover 214 typically stays on UK roads for around 36 years. At 32 years old, this Rover 214 is approaching the upper end of the typical lifespan for this model.
